To truly appreciate pseohipodromose, it's essential to understand the context of SESC Plata. SESC, as a nationwide organization, plays a vital role in Brazil's social and cultural landscape. Funded by contributions from businesses in the commerce sector, SESC provides a wide array of services and programs aimed at improving the quality of life for workers and their families. These offerings include educational courses, health services, recreational activities, artistic performances, and much more.
